There's a shift occurring in just how younger generations discuss cash. For Gen Z, the days of peaceful budgeting where financial resources were managed discreetly behind closed doors are swiftly fading. In its area, a strong, unapologetic trend has actually emerged: loud budgeting.


Exactly what is loud budgeting? It's an activity that welcomes financial openness. It's about being singing with your friends when you can't manage a pricey supper out. It's concerning selecting a more affordable trip and happily describing why. It's budgeting with self-confidence and, most notably, without shame. For Gen Z, loud budgeting isn't simply a technique, it's a kind of self-expression and empowerment.


Why Loud Budgeting Resonates with Gen Z


Gen Z has matured in the shadow of significant economic occasions from the 2008 economic crisis to the pandemic economic climate. A lot of them saw their moms and dads deal with financial obligation, real estate instability, or job insecurity. Therefore, this generation is hyper-aware of the importance of monetary stability, but they're rewriting the rulebook in how they approach it.


They're not afraid to speak about their cash goals. Whether they're paying off pupil lendings, saving for their initial apartment, or contributing to a money market account, Gen Z thinks that financial discussions should be sincere and stabilized. By turning budgeting into something you state aloud rather than hiding, they're removing the preconception that so usually features individual money conversations.


This type of openness likewise creates accountability. When you tell your buddies, I'm not spending extra this month because I'm saving for a car, it not just enhances your monetary goal yet assists others appreciate your boundaries and perhaps even motivates them to embrace similar behaviors.


Social media site and the Power of Financial Storytelling


Systems like TikTok and Instagram have played a big duty in magnifying this pattern. What could have when been thought about exclusive, like month-to-month costs break downs or total assets milestones, is currently shared in brief videos, economic vlogs, and candid inscriptions. These messages aren't showing off riches; they're showing what genuine finance appears like.


Gen Z isn't simply showing off what they can acquire. They're talking about just how much they conserve, how they stay clear of debt, and what their monetary obstacles are. There's something deeply relatable and motivating regarding watching somebody your age clarify why they're meal prepping instead of buying takeout or just how they're using personal loans to consolidate charge card debt and decrease economic tension.


Loud budgeting, by doing this, comes to be a form of community-building. It states: You're not the only one. I'm figuring this out too. Which cumulative openness is one of the most empowering features of the activity.

Just How Loud Budgeting Shapes Conversations Around Debt


Among the most effective elements of this trend is how it's transforming the narrative around debt. In previous generations, lugging financial obligation, especially customer financial obligation, was typically a source of embarassment. It was kept quiet, concealed below a polished outside.


Gen Z, however, is reframing financial debt as something to be comprehended, took care of, and even spoke about freely. They're sharing their pupil financing reward trips, talking about the benefits and drawbacks of using charge card, and explaining exactly how this page they're leveraging personal loans for critical reasons, not out of despair.


This sort of honesty produces room for real conversations. It urges smarter decision-making and decreases the stress and anxiety and seclusion that frequently feature economic struggles.
